Shenzhen hanhua technology co, ltd Trademarks
SHANGRLA

SHANGRLA

Filed: August 18, 2021
3D decals for use on any surface; Adhesive labels made of paper; Decals and stickers for use as home decor; Disposable napkins…
Owned by: Shenzhen hanhua technology co, ltd
Serial Number: 90890189